差别很小。tsx显然允许在TypeScript中使用jsx标记,但这引入了一些解析歧义,这使得tsx略有不同。根据我...
只能在 TypeScript 文件中使用TypeScript是一种由微软开发的开源编程语言,它是JavaScript的超集,为JavaScript添加了静态类型检查和其他一些新的语言特性。TypeScript中,我们可以使用类、接口、模块等高级语言特性来编写结构化的代码,并且可以通过类型检查来减少错误和提高代码可维护性。TypeScript中,我们只能在TypeScript文件...
让我们来转译一个简单的 TypeScript Hello World 程序。 步骤1:创建一个简单的TS文件 在一个空文件夹中打开 VS Code,创建一个 helloworld.ts 文件,在该文件中输入以下代码... let message: string = 'Hello World'; console.log(message); 要测试您是否正确安装了 TypeScript 编译器 tsc 和一个正常运行的...
VS Code 的 TypeScript 功能也适用于 JSX。要在 TypeScript 中使用 JSX,请使用 *.tsx 文件扩展名,而不是普通的 *.ts: VS Code 还包含特定于 JSX 的功能,如在 TypeScript 中自动关闭 JSX 标记: 0 将"typescript.autoClosingTags" 设置为 false 以禁用 JSX 标签关闭。 JSDoc 支持 VS Code 的 TypeScript...
VSCode是一款功能强大的开源代码编辑器,支持多种编程语言和开发环境。它提供了丰富的扩展和插件,可以满足开发者在各种项目中的需求。 对于具有.ts和.tsx扩展名的文件的导入,VSCode提供了一...
搭建TypeScript 的运行环境 TypeScript 的编译环境 TypeScript 的编译过程: 首先我们可以全局安装 TypeScript npmitypescript -g 安装好 typescript 后,可以查看 tsc 版本 tsc--version 结果会打印如下: Version 5.4.4 安装好 TypeScript 编译器之后,可以通过 tsc 命令对 TypeScript 代码进行编译,如下示例, main....
tsx文件 飘红类型注释只能在 TypeScript 文件中使用 ts中的typeof,keyof获取类型内所有的key,即所有属性名,获取的是一个联合类型这里类型指:通过interface或type定义的类型;通过typeofxxx返回的类型等。keyof后面必须是类型,不能是具体的对象interfaceIPeople{name:str
tsx 支持零配置(无需)使用。 执行指令即可体验效果。或是通过的脚本: {"scripts":{"dev":"tsx..."}} 执行,能看到一样的效果。 使用 执行TypeScript 文件 tsx ./file.ts TypeScript 文件代码可以使用 ES Module 语法,也可以使用 CommonJS 模块语,都支持。
使用vue-cli 3.0 创建一个项目 , 必选 typescript Babel ,其他根据需要选。创建完成后已经引入了Vue 及 TS 相关包了,也包括上面提到的 vue-property-decorator。包含了一个实例代码,npm install,npm run serve 已经可以跑起来了。 导入和配置 1. 安装 vue-tsx-support 包 ...
TypeScript 1.5 的版本:术语名已经发生了变化,“内部模块”的概念更接近于大部分人眼中的“命名空间”, 所以自此之后称作“命名空间”(也就是说 module X {…} 相当于现在推荐的写法 namespace X {…}),而 "外部模块" 对于 JS 来讲就是模块(ES6 模块系统将每个文件视为一个模块),所以自此之后简称为“模块...